This sets up a fake log stream on the
// Pebbleworks staging aggregator with three rotating files so we
// can verify that `tailman follow --merge` handles rotation
// without duplicating lines. The stream emits one entry per
// 50ms; tests assert ordering and backpressure behavior. Keep
// the emit rate in sync with the throttle constant in
// stream_config.go. The fixture connects to the staging
// aggregator API, which authenticates with the bearer token
// below.

portal login ticket: eyJhbGciOiJIUzI1NiIsInR5cCI6IkpXVCJ9.eyJzdWIiOiIMjvRAf3PEFIn0.nuv9gjixLtnr

Runbook: GarageGlance occupancy feed

If the Harborview Deck occupancy feed goes stale (no updates for 5+ minutes), first check the sensor gateway health page. Green but stale usually means the aggregator queue is backed up; restart the aggregator via the ops console and counts should recover within two minutes. If spots show negative numbers, force a full recount from the camera snapshots. When escalating to engineering, include the trace token shown below.

session token of yawif-kahof = htk9_dd6996ed6

# The Corvexa 3.1 planner has a known regression where
# cost estimates for partial indexes are inflated, so custom
# plugins that issue range queries may see full scans.
# Workaround: keep enable_partial_cost_fix = true and do not
# override statistics targets from plugin code. Test plans
# against the shared regression database, not production.
# The regression database is reachable at the connection
# string on the next line.

replica DSN, fahif-bagag: cockroachdb://casok_svc:V7@db-3280.zemvarsoft.example:5432/briion